Merge branch 'main' of https://gitea.staxriver.com/staxriver/padelclub_backend into main
commit
9e832fa447
@ -0,0 +1,61 @@ |
||||
<div class="cell medium-12 large-3 my-block"> |
||||
<div class="bubble"> |
||||
<label class="matchtitle">{{ player.name }}</label> |
||||
|
||||
<div> |
||||
<div class="match-result bottom-border" style="padding-right: 10px;"> |
||||
<div class="player"> |
||||
<div class="single-line"> |
||||
<strong>{{ player.clean_club_name }}</strong> |
||||
</div> |
||||
</div> |
||||
</div> |
||||
|
||||
<div class="match-result bottom-border"> |
||||
<div class="player"> |
||||
<div class="semibold"> |
||||
<strong>Classement</strong> |
||||
</div> |
||||
</div> |
||||
<div class="scores"> |
||||
<span class="score ws numbers">{{ player.format_ordinal }}</span> |
||||
</div> |
||||
</div> |
||||
|
||||
<div class="match-result bottom-border"> |
||||
<div class="player"> |
||||
<div class="semibold"> |
||||
<strong>Age</strong> |
||||
</div> |
||||
</div> |
||||
<div class="scores"> |
||||
<span class="score ws numbers"> |
||||
{{ player.calculate_age|default:"?" }} ans |
||||
</span> |
||||
</div> |
||||
</div> |
||||
|
||||
<div class="match-result bottom-border"> |
||||
<div class="player"> |
||||
<div class="semibold"> |
||||
<strong>Points</strong> |
||||
</div> |
||||
</div> |
||||
<div class="scores"> |
||||
<span class="score ws numbers">{{ player.points|default:"0" }} pts</span> |
||||
</div> |
||||
</div> |
||||
|
||||
<div class="match-result"> |
||||
<div class="player"> |
||||
<div class="semibold"> |
||||
<strong>Tournois joués</strong> |
||||
</div> |
||||
</div> |
||||
<div class="scores"> |
||||
<span class="score ws numbers">{{ player.tournament_played|default:"0" }}</span> |
||||
</div> |
||||
</div> |
||||
</div> |
||||
</div> |
||||
</div> |
||||
@ -0,0 +1,54 @@ |
||||
{% extends 'tournaments/base.html' %} |
||||
|
||||
{% block head_title %}Équipes du {{ tournament.display_name }}{% endblock %} |
||||
{% block first_title %}{{ tournament.event.display_name }}{% endblock %} |
||||
{% block second_title %}{{ tournament.display_name }}{% endblock %} |
||||
|
||||
{% block content %} |
||||
<div class="grid-x grid-margin-x"> |
||||
<style> |
||||
.bubble { |
||||
height: 100%; |
||||
} |
||||
</style> |
||||
<div class="cell medium-12"> |
||||
<h1 class="club my-block topmargin20">{{ team.formatted_team_names }}</h1> |
||||
<div class="grid-x"> |
||||
{% for player in team.playerregistration_set.all %} |
||||
{% include 'tournaments/player_row.html' with player=player %} |
||||
{% endfor %} |
||||
{% include 'tournaments/team_stats.html' %} |
||||
</div> |
||||
</div> |
||||
</div> |
||||
|
||||
<div class="grid-x grid-margin-x"> |
||||
{% with upcoming_matches=team.get_upcoming_matches %} |
||||
{% if upcoming_matches %} |
||||
<!-- Upcoming Matches --> |
||||
<div class="cell medium-12"> |
||||
<h1 class="club my-block topmargin20">Prochains matchs</h1> |
||||
<div class="grid-x"> |
||||
{% for match in upcoming_matches %} |
||||
{% include 'tournaments/match_cell.html' %} |
||||
{% endfor %} |
||||
</div> |
||||
</div> |
||||
{% endif %} |
||||
{% endwith %} |
||||
|
||||
{% with completed_matches=team.get_completed_matches %} |
||||
{% if completed_matches %} |
||||
<!-- Completed Matches --> |
||||
<div class="cell medium-12"> |
||||
<h1 class="club my-block topmargin20">Matchs terminés</h1> |
||||
<div class="grid-x"> |
||||
{% for match in completed_matches %} |
||||
{% include 'tournaments/match_cell.html' %} |
||||
{% endfor %} |
||||
</div> |
||||
</div> |
||||
{% endif %} |
||||
{% endwith %} |
||||
</div> |
||||
{% endblock %} |
||||
@ -0,0 +1,72 @@ |
||||
<div class="cell medium-12 large-3 my-block"> |
||||
<div class="bubble"> |
||||
<label class="matchtitle">Statistiques du tournoi</label> |
||||
|
||||
<div> |
||||
{% with stats=team.get_statistics %} |
||||
{% if stats.final_ranking %} |
||||
<div class="match-result bottom-border"> |
||||
<div class="player"> |
||||
<div class="semibold"> |
||||
<strong>Classement final</strong> |
||||
</div> |
||||
</div> |
||||
<div class="scores"> |
||||
<span class="score ws numbers">{{ stats.final_ranking }}</span> |
||||
</div> |
||||
</div> |
||||
{% endif %} |
||||
|
||||
{% if stats.points_earned %} |
||||
<div class="match-result bottom-border"> |
||||
<div class="player"> |
||||
<div class="semibold"> |
||||
<strong>Points gagnés</strong> |
||||
</div> |
||||
</div> |
||||
<div class="scores"> |
||||
<span class="score ws numbers">{{ stats.points_earned }} pts</span> |
||||
</div> |
||||
</div> |
||||
{% endif %} |
||||
|
||||
{% if stats.initial_stage %} |
||||
<div class="match-result bottom-border"> |
||||
<div class="player"> |
||||
<div class="semibold"> |
||||
<strong>Départ</strong> |
||||
</div> |
||||
</div> |
||||
<div class="scores"> |
||||
<span class="score ws numbers">{{ stats.initial_stage }}</span> |
||||
</div> |
||||
</div> |
||||
{% endif %} |
||||
|
||||
<div class="match-result bottom-border"> |
||||
<div class="player"> |
||||
<div class="semibold"> |
||||
<strong>Matchs joués</strong> |
||||
</div> |
||||
</div> |
||||
<div class="scores"> |
||||
<span class="score ws numbers">{{ stats.matches_played }}</span> |
||||
</div> |
||||
</div> |
||||
|
||||
{% if stats.victory_ratio %} |
||||
<div class="match-result"> |
||||
<div class="player"> |
||||
<div class="semibold"> |
||||
<strong>Ratio victoires</strong> |
||||
</div> |
||||
</div> |
||||
<div class="scores"> |
||||
<span class="score ws numbers">{{ stats.victory_ratio }}</span> |
||||
</div> |
||||
</div> |
||||
{% endif %} |
||||
{% endwith %} |
||||
</div> |
||||
</div> |
||||
</div> |
||||
Loading…
Reference in new issue